Online Maps

Our online mapping service uses a GIS (Geographic Information System) to enable you to view:

  • Property and valuation information
  • Water supply, stormwater and wastewater networks
  • Operative District Plan layers
  • Aerial photographs

Bay of Plenty Maps

Bay of Plenty Maps allows you to access web maps and applications relating to local government in the Bay of Plenty region. The maps are all interactive and include community, recreational and environmental information.

Bay of Plenty Regional Council, Tauranga City Council, Western Bay of Plenty District Council and Whakatāne District Council have provided data for the maps. The Bay of Plenty Maps portal is managed by the Bay of Plenty Regional Council.

Retrolens - Historical Image Resource

Search for an address or location and go back in time — as far back as the 1930s — to see what the land was like in years gone by. Retrolens is managed by LINZ and is a jointly-funded project of various local authorities and services, including BoPLASS and the Bay of Plenty Regional Council.

Digital versions of historical Crown aerial imagery are continually being added as part of this project, with all of the Bay of Plenty region's archival aerial photos expected to be available by June 2018.

LINZ Lidar Data

Lidar data from Land Information New Zealand (LINZ) is available via OpenTopography. LINZ has a partnership with OpenTopography allowing 3D point cloud data to be downloaded, processed and visualised. This partnership complements the publishing of DEM and DSM products on the LINZ Data Service (LDS). This service is managed by LINZ and not Whakatāne District Council.
